Story/Characters

 

How dark can TSL be? In KotOR Taris and Dantooine are both destroyed no matter what path you take. So I guess making the game "darker" would be making more destruction like that, no matter what path you take.

 

A darker story doesn't necessarily mean more mass destruction. Sometimes it's the more personal tragedies that make the mood more somber or 'dark'.

 

In saying that, keep in mind that I actually don't know a whole lot of the story of the game. Most of it is in the designers' heads more than in docs, and I don't have a lot of time to read story docs to begin with. Too busy coding.

 

But I know how Avellone writes, and I do know a few details or ideas that are going to happen. -Akari

 

We are trying to create more dark side options so you don't have to be "psychotic evil". -John Morgan

 

Will the game prompt you to ask NPCs what is wrong like KOTOR?

 

There will be no instances in K2 where you will be prompted by the game to ask a CNPC what's wrong. Any issues or problems the CNPC has can be brought up if you ask them, or will occur in a context-relevant event. There will be instances where they initiate conversation with you, but it won't always be about their companion quest or whatever problems they're having. -Chris Avellone

 

Devs will there be battle scenes where ALL of your party is fighting?

 

I can safely say no, though there may be moments where most of them are trying to pound the crap out of a particularly bad foe, but having full control over all of them won't happen. -Chris Avellone

 

Will there be Selkath, Rakata, Ewoks or the like in KOTOR:TSL?

 

I wouldn't mind a Selkath (there are no Selkath planned for K2, however), but there will be no Rakata in K2. I thought the Selkath were pretty cool - that creepy voice made them perfect. -Chris Avellone

 

No Ewoks or Jawas. Or Gungans. Or any of the pod-racing aliens. -Chris Avellone

 

I heard the guy on the start screen for KOTOR:TSL changes. Is this random?

 

It isn't randomized, no.

As to the # of Sith Lords, it isn't one per planet, but thats all I'll say on that.

As to your character appearing there... hm.... -Akari

 

Will the main character have amnesia?

 

The player does not have amnesia, does not start the game with amnesia, does not get amnesia over the course of the game, and he/she is quite clear who, what, and where he is at all times. Nor does he/she have any problems with memory, lurking pseudo-personalities, multiple personality disorders, submerged personalities, or any personality problems except what you induce through gameplay by being a nice guy, a jerk, or both. -Chris Avellone

 

Will I be able to play a non-human as my main character?

 

PC is human only, male or female, like the first game. -Chris Avellone

 

I heard there isn't going to be romance in KOTOR:TSL Is this true?

 

His wording was 'aren't tied solely to romance'. He wasn't saying that there isn't going to be any, but that the NPC interactions are going to be based on more than just romance. -Akari

 

CGW says you'll have 10 npcs to choose from, but it also says that you will get different ones depending if yoru light, dark, male, female....so does that mean there are more than 10 npcs that will join you, in total?

 

Yes. -Akari

 

The total number of NPCs you can get going through a particular path of the game is 10. But there are more than 10 total potential NPCs in the game. You will never reach a situation where you are forced to chose what NPC to get rid of because you've run out of party slots. -Akari

 

To be honest, the TOTAL number of possible NPCs is still in a state of flux right now. There isn't a finalized number. And even if they were, I'd probably leave it to designer descretion to give the number out. -Akari

My question is: Are you guys thinking of maybe putting some type of multi-player options for the XBox Live? What I mean is, when you log onto XBox Live you have an option of taking your 3 party members from your last saved game and fight them against another 3 party members from a friend/neighbor's saved game.

Interesting idea, but no. There will definitely not be any multi-player support. The client/server structure of the Aurora engine was broken during the development of KotOR1 (since it didn't need multiplayer support either). It would be a major overhaul to make the engine capable of multiplayer again. It's just not going to happen.

 

-Akari
